1976 Supreme(SC) 278

A.C.GUPTA, P.K.GOSWAMI, Y.V.CHANDRACHUD
S. Ramaswamy – Appellant
Versus
Union Of India – Respondent


Advocates:
B.R.G.K.Achar, GIRISH CHANDRA, P.S.NARASIMHA, Sabha Dikshit, SHYAMALA PAPPU

JUDGMENT

Chandrachud, J.:—On February 7, 1959 the appellant, S. Ramaswamy, was appointed as an Assistant Development Officer in the Directorate General of Technical Development in the Ministry of Industry and Civil Supplies, Government of India. In 1964 he was appointed as a Development Officer on an ad hoc basis and that appointment was regularized in May, 1966. On December 1, 1966 the post of Officer on Special Duty was created in the Directorate in order to deal effectively with the development of agrobased food processing industries. The Director General (Technical Development) recommended the appellant for appointment to the post and in course of time the appointment was duly made.

2. In 1974 a question arose regarding promotion to the selection post of Industrial Adviser in the Directorate, Respondents 6 to 11 and some others who were working as Development Officers filed writ petition No. 612 of 1974 in the Delhi High Court asking that the Government of India be restrained from promoting the appellant to the post of Industrial Adviser and that their claims to the post be considered in preference to the appellants claim. that petition was dismissed on September 17, 1975.
